In the United States and numerous other nations, a dietitian is a board-certified food and nourishment professional. They are very informed in the area of nourishment and dietetics the scientific research of food, nourishment, and their effect on human wellness. Via comprehensive training, dietitians acquire the competence to provide evidence-based medical nourishment treatment and dietary counseling tailored to satisfy a person's needs.
-1To make clear, the credentials of RD and RDN are compatible. Nevertheless, RDN is an extra recent classification. Dietitians can pick which credential they prefer to make use of. To make these qualifications dietitians-to-be have to initially earn a bachelor's level or equivalent credit scores from an accredited program at an university or college. Typically, this requires an undergraduate scientific research level, including courses in biology, microbiology, organic and inorganic chemistry, biochemistry, anatomy, and physiology, along with more specialized nourishment coursework.

Dietitians are qualified to take care of nourishment treatment across a span of severe and chronic conditions. The kind of problems they deal with depends most on the setup of their method.
In numerous states, such as Alaska, Florida, Illinois, Maryland, Massachusetts, and Pennsylvania, RDs and CNSs are granted the exact same state permit, typically called a Certified Dietitian Nutritional Expert (LDN) certificate. In states that don't regulate making use of this term, any person with a rate of interest in diet or nutrition might call themselves a nutritionist.
-1Nonetheless, since uncredentialed nutritionists typically do not have the competence and training for clinical nutrition therapy and nutrition therapy, following their recommendations can be considered harmful (). Before speaking with a nutritionist, you might desire to inspect whether your state manages that might utilize this title. In the united state states that do not control the term, no degrees or qualifications are needed to be a nutritionist.
In states that do mandate licensure, the CNS or RD credential might required. Those with CNS credentials are health specialists like nurses or physicians with advanced wellness degrees who have actually sought extra coursework, completed monitored practice hours, and passed a test supervised by the Board for Accreditation of Nourishment Specialists.

-1In Australia there is a distinction between a dietitian and other nutritional health carriers consisting of nutritional experts. All dietitians are nutritional experts, but nutritionists without a dietetics certification can't call themselves a dietitian.
-1Dietitians with the Accredited Practising Dietitian (APD) credential dedicate to continuous training and education and learning throughout their jobs. They follow our code of conduct. Dietitians have the understanding and abilities discovered in the National Expertise Criteria for Dietitians. As an occupation, nutritional experts are not controlled in Australia under NASRHP or certified under a single regulatory body.
If you have a persistent health and wellness condition and a treatment plan from your general practitioner, you might be able to claim a Medicare refund when you see an APD.
